OpenID for Firefox - learns about your OpenIDs when you use them. A click on the OpenID icon in the url bar inserts your preferred OpenID into an input field named "openid_url" on web pages. Dragging that icon to an input field inserts your preferred OpenID to that input field when clicking alone does not work.
Adds the function "window.openid.getPreferredOpenidProvider()" to the DOM. Websites can use this function to query your preferred OpenID.
